Pateregaon in context

With 404 people at the 2011 Census, Pateregaon was the 1132nd most populous of its district's 1537 villages, below the district average of 879.

The sex ratio was 1160 women per 1,000 men (16 above the district's rural figure of 1144) — one of the minority of villages where women outnumbered men.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 700, 223 below the rural national 923.
